Explanation: Plastic plates are commonly made from polystyrene plastics, which are a type of synthetic polymer. Polystyrene is a versatile material that is widely used in various applications due to its unique properties. The primary reasons for using polystyrene in the manufacture of plastic plates include its lightweight nature, durability, and low cost.
Polystyrene is a thermoplastic polymer that is derived from styrene, a liquid hydrocarbon. It can be produced in two main forms: expanded polystyrene (EPS) and general-purpose polystyrene (GPPS). EPS is often used in packaging and insulation, while GPPS is more commonly used in the production of disposable plates, cups, and other food containers.
The manufacturing process for plastic plates involves molding the polystyrene into the desired shape. This is typically done through injection molding or vacuum forming. Injection molding involves injecting molten polystyrene into a mold, which is then cooled and solidified to form the plate. Vacuum forming involves heating a sheet of polystyrene and then shaping it over a mold using a vacuum to create the final product.
Polystyrene is chosen for plastic plates because it is lightweight, which makes it easy to transport and handle. It is also relatively inexpensive, making it a cost-effective material for disposable items. Additionally, polystyrene is resistant to moisture, which is important for food containers that may come into contact with liquids. It is also easy to mold into various shapes and sizes, allowing for a wide range of designs and functionalities.
It is important to note that while polystyrene is widely used for plastic plates, other types of plastics such as polyvinyl chloride (PVC) and polycarbonate are not typically used for this purpose. PVC is more commonly used in construction materials and pipes due to its durability and resistance to moisture, while polycarbonate is used in applications requiring high impact resistance, such as safety glasses and CDs.
